Solid model on the AR-16 rifle

In my off time, work has been completed on the AR-16 upper receiver right side. In case you don’t remember this rifle it is a 308 predecessor of the AR-180. Only 4 were made and of those only 2 are known to exist. I had the opportunity to photograph one a while back at the Reed Knight collection.

Archive Photo’s 3-12

I shot these pictures while at Woolwick at the Rotunda. It was an absolutely great museum. It has since been closed down and replaced with a typical diorama walk through everything behind glass museum. In its day it was a place where you could study some small arms, but mostly artillery up close. I spent numerous vacations there.

This is a weapon design by an unknown Africaan during the Boer war to keep the heads of the British soldiers down while they escaped. It is a clock weapon. The feed device seems to be missing but what you would do with this weapons is to set it for how fast you wanted the weapon to fire. One round a minute or one round every 5 minutes or more.

clock pistol_Page_1c1sA side view showing the complete size of the weapon

clock pistol_Page_2c1sIn this picture you can see the cartridge being picked up to be fed into the barrel

clock pistol_Page_3c1sI am not sure this was ever used or just a prototype that was made and not completed. It is however an interesting design and concept.

Fun at Gun Lab Week end of 3-8-15

Not everything is as much fun as this was.

DSC_3795s

My old back hoe started leaking oil on two of the cylinders. So the project for Sunday was to remove the cylinders to take them down to the hydraulic repair shop. As with all plans things just do not go as easy as they sound. The bushings had shattered and would not allow the cylinders to come out. The pins could move but the bushings needed to be driven out. So a special tool was made for this task. The pin was machined to fit the inside of the bushing and be the exact same diameter as the bushing.

DSC_4569s

Then all the tools necessary to remove the bushings were gathered together.

DSC_4572s

So there were two cylinders and 12 bushings to remove. This is the video of the last one.

It took the better part of Sunday to finish this job.

VG1-5 update

It has been a while since we have chatted about the VG1-5 so I thought an update was in order. All the individual parts have been made and the first non-firing copy was made. This last weekend we finished a testing example to try and determine if any problems exist. We looked at everything from the barrel chamber and flutes to the firing pin length. We needed to check the recoil spring length and tension. Is the buffer spring to strong or weak. Will the fire control group work properly. All the drawings showed that everything should work but these are all questions that can only be answered during a test fire.

The test rifle that we made uses all the same parts that the rifles we are going to sell but uses parts that we can not sell. We actually ended up with 2 receivers that did not come out as nice as I would like. One will be sent to the ATFE for approval and the other will be shot to death with proof loads to determine strength and safety.

So a very basic testing rig was made to hook up to the firing tube and testing began.

DSC_4546sThe initial test showed the firing pin worked properly but it was not ejecting properly and the cases were falling back into the receiver.

We then lengthened the ejector and re-tested the rifle. The rifle fire and ejected properly. These are the fired cases after the ejector was lengthened.

So far the tests have been successful. Then we tested for proper engagement of the secondary sear. The manually testing we did showed good engagement and the disconnector operated properly. However during actual live fire testing the secondary sear did not catch properly.

This is a video of the tests.

 

We should have the secondary sear problem corrected and then we will test proper magazine feed and proof the rifle

New area at Gun Lab

Part of what was accomplished this last weekend was going through old photo’s that I have taken over the last 40 years and started converting them to digital format. These are pictures of cannons, tanks, aircraft and of course small arms. Some are just a basic picture and some are very detailed photo’s of individual weapons. I have decided to do a once a week archive post. A great deal of these pictures I have no idea what there are, just that the individual item interested me. Most of these were taken with either a cheap 35 mm camera or my better 35mm camera, so if think my digital pictures are bad, well these will probably be worse. The thing is that most of these museums have since boxed up these items and they are no longer out for viewing some even destroyed. Even some of the private items have been sold and lost to the rest of us.

This first picture was taken over 38 years ago in Charleston, South Carolina at the battery. This is a picture perfect location with some of the nicest people that you will ever meet. In fact I met my wife in Charleston 35 years ago and we walked this park on a number of occasions.

This is a Hotchkiss revolving cannon. I don’t know if it is still there or not, but if it is you should take a visit there.
